Dictionary Results for sorbent:
1. WordNet® 3.0 (2006)
sorbent
    n 1: a material that sorbs another substance; i.e. that has the
         capacity or tendency to take it up by either absorption or
         adsorption [syn: sorbent, sorbent material]

2. The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48
Sorbent \Sorb"ent\, n. [L. sorbens, p. pr. of sorbere to suck
   in, to absorb.]
   An absorbent. [R.]
   [1913 Webster]
